Ruydar Rural District (Persian: دهستان رویدر) is in Ruydar District of Khamir County, Hormozgan province, Iran.[3] It is administered from the city of Ruydar.[4]

At the National Census of 2006, its population was 8,549 in 1,974 households.[5] There were 3,589 inhabitants in 974 households at the following census of 2011.[6] At the most recent census of 2016, the population of the rural district was 3,745 in 1,185 households. The largest of its 22 villages was Karuiyeh, with 1,142 people.[2]
